Miray RAM Drive lets you temporarily use part of the system memory as a disk drive. All within a simple environment. This RAM disk creator lets you create a virtual hard disk on demand, using part of your RAM. This action is ideal for tasks that require processing.
Once you download the application from its official page, you'll see that it starts working from the desktop taskbar. Explaining how the tool works is quite complicated, but using it is really simple. Simply click the utility icon and select the amount of megabytes you'll assign to the virtual disk, then click the green button. And that's it!
At that moment, the platform will begin creating the virtual disk, taking the megabytes from your RAM.
Access to the disk works the same way as conventional drives, and to delete it you'll need to click the power button.
